Output 4869c6b83f86f99d66e5b9ecc42c8c39a93c4453178ae7a18b0338aae4965044:7

value
536219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f46ea1102a42c5a5f9ace1d8210627fa2f81d7e OP_EQUAL
address
34YPphnRGoHe2PGh6MK2idojzk2gmEGRvL
transaction
4869c6b83f86f99d66e5b9ecc42c8c39a93c4453178ae7a18b0338aae4965044
confirmations
181489
spent
true